]> git.r.bdr.sh - rbdr/forum/log
rbdr/forum
4 months agoDon't remember what this WIP was about main
Ruben Beltran del Rio [Sun, 24 Dec 2023 11:31:07 +0000 (12:31 +0100)]
Don't remember what this WIP was about

23 months agoLint, rm unused code
Ruben Beltran del Rio [Mon, 30 May 2022 23:09:58 +0000 (01:09 +0200)]
Lint, rm unused code

23 months agoUse supabase
Ruben Beltran del Rio [Mon, 30 May 2022 23:04:10 +0000 (01:04 +0200)]
Use supabase

2 years agoStart migration to supabase
Ruben Beltran del Rio [Tue, 17 May 2022 21:43:30 +0000 (23:43 +0200)]
Start migration to supabase

2 years agoUpdate apollo
Ruben Beltran del Rio [Tue, 17 May 2022 20:10:36 +0000 (22:10 +0200)]
Update apollo

2 years agoUpdate eslint
Ruben Beltran del Rio [Sun, 1 May 2022 14:21:40 +0000 (16:21 +0200)]
Update eslint

2 years agoAdd typedoc
Ruben Beltran del Rio [Sun, 1 May 2022 13:10:56 +0000 (15:10 +0200)]
Add typedoc

2 years agoAdd svelte check
Ruben Beltran del Rio [Sun, 1 May 2022 13:04:33 +0000 (15:04 +0200)]
Add svelte check

2 years agoAdjust formatting of jest
Ruben Beltran del Rio [Sun, 1 May 2022 13:03:27 +0000 (15:03 +0200)]
Adjust formatting of jest

2 years agoAdd options from svelte tsconfig
Ruben Beltran del Rio [Sun, 1 May 2022 13:03:07 +0000 (15:03 +0200)]
Add options from svelte tsconfig

2 years agoAdd font stacks to tailwind
Ruben Beltran del Rio [Sun, 1 May 2022 13:02:56 +0000 (15:02 +0200)]
Add font stacks to tailwind

2 years agoUse tailwind in app html
Ruben Beltran del Rio [Sun, 1 May 2022 13:02:39 +0000 (15:02 +0200)]
Use tailwind in app html

2 years agoUse tailwind, reference types
Ruben Beltran del Rio [Sun, 1 May 2022 13:01:50 +0000 (15:01 +0200)]
Use tailwind, reference types

2 years agoAdd type definitions
Ruben Beltran del Rio [Sun, 1 May 2022 13:01:31 +0000 (15:01 +0200)]
Add type definitions

2 years agoUpdate Gitlab CI version
Ruben Beltran del Rio [Sun, 1 May 2022 07:44:28 +0000 (09:44 +0200)]
Update Gitlab CI version

2 years agoRemove outdated docs
Ruben Beltran del Rio [Sun, 1 May 2022 07:43:38 +0000 (09:43 +0200)]
Remove outdated docs

2 years agoRemove icloud files
Ruben Beltran del Rio [Sun, 1 May 2022 07:42:10 +0000 (09:42 +0200)]
Remove icloud files

2 years agoCollect coverage in tests
Ruben Beltran del Rio [Sat, 30 Apr 2022 23:16:46 +0000 (01:16 +0200)]
Collect coverage in tests

2 years agoApply formatting
Ruben Beltran del Rio [Sat, 30 Apr 2022 23:02:58 +0000 (01:02 +0200)]
Apply formatting

2 years agoUpdate / use typescript
Ruben Beltran del Rio [Sat, 30 Apr 2022 22:56:06 +0000 (00:56 +0200)]
Update / use typescript

2 years agoUpdate sveltekit version
Ruben Beltran del Rio [Mon, 28 Jun 2021 21:38:23 +0000 (23:38 +0200)]
Update sveltekit version

3 years agoUpdate documentation
Ruben Beltran del Rio [Mon, 3 May 2021 19:18:29 +0000 (21:18 +0200)]
Update documentation

3 years agoAdd tests for actions + pacts for graphql errrors
Ruben Beltran del Rio [Mon, 3 May 2021 18:59:55 +0000 (20:59 +0200)]
Add tests for actions + pacts for graphql errrors

3 years agoAdd topics store pact tests
Ruben Beltran del Rio [Sun, 2 May 2021 18:39:30 +0000 (20:39 +0200)]
Add topics store pact tests

3 years agoAdd tags store pact tests
Ruben Beltran del Rio [Sun, 2 May 2021 18:16:44 +0000 (20:16 +0200)]
Add tags store pact tests

3 years agoAdd posts store pact test
Ruben Beltran del Rio [Sun, 2 May 2021 17:53:10 +0000 (19:53 +0200)]
Add posts store pact test

3 years agoAdd error/empty cases for forums
Ruben Beltran del Rio [Sun, 2 May 2021 15:08:43 +0000 (17:08 +0200)]
Add error/empty cases for forums

3 years agoAdd getForum pact, normalize stores
Ruben Beltran del Rio [Sun, 2 May 2021 11:37:11 +0000 (13:37 +0200)]
Add getForum pact, normalize stores

3 years agoAdd pact test for forums store
Ruben Beltran del Rio [Sat, 1 May 2021 22:23:16 +0000 (00:23 +0200)]
Add pact test for forums store

3 years agoAdd tests for header
Ruben Beltran del Rio [Thu, 22 Apr 2021 21:02:02 +0000 (23:02 +0200)]
Add tests for header

Also patches up the leaky abstraction on the actions

3 years agoUpdate dependencies
Ruben Beltran del Rio [Thu, 22 Apr 2021 21:01:43 +0000 (23:01 +0200)]
Update dependencies

3 years agoMock config for tests
Ruben Beltran del Rio [Thu, 22 Apr 2021 20:58:52 +0000 (22:58 +0200)]
Mock config for tests

Treat it as an external... also, deals better with the
vite meta things

3 years agoAdd test for forum topic list
Ruben Beltran del Rio [Wed, 21 Apr 2021 22:58:09 +0000 (00:58 +0200)]
Add test for forum topic list

Also adds URL test for tag topic list

3 years agoUpdate dependencies
Ruben Beltran del Rio [Wed, 21 Apr 2021 22:44:38 +0000 (00:44 +0200)]
Update dependencies

3 years agoAdd gitlab CI config
Ruben Beltran del Rio [Wed, 21 Apr 2021 22:41:15 +0000 (00:41 +0200)]
Add gitlab CI config

3 years agoRemove commented code + fix ttypo
Ruben Beltran del Rio [Wed, 21 Apr 2021 22:19:58 +0000 (00:19 +0200)]
Remove commented code + fix ttypo

3 years agoAdd blink test + coverage improvements
Ruben Beltran del Rio [Wed, 21 Apr 2021 22:18:28 +0000 (00:18 +0200)]
Add blink test + coverage improvements

3 years agoAdd tests to second batch of components
Ruben Beltran del Rio [Tue, 20 Apr 2021 21:38:02 +0000 (23:38 +0200)]
Add tests to second batch of components

- Error Block
- Forum List
- Language Selector
- Post
- Tag
- Topic Summary

3 years agoAdd tests for first batch of components
Ruben Beltran del Rio [Mon, 19 Apr 2021 19:04:59 +0000 (21:04 +0200)]
Add tests for first batch of components

- Glyph
- Forum List
- Error Block
- Post

3 years agoUse babel-eslint as linter parser
Ruben Beltran del Rio [Sat, 17 Apr 2021 10:36:29 +0000 (12:36 +0200)]
Use babel-eslint as linter parser

3 years agoAdd jest for testing
Ruben Beltran del Rio [Sat, 17 Apr 2021 10:36:06 +0000 (12:36 +0200)]
Add jest for testing

3 years agoAdd tests for utils
Ruben Beltran del Rio [Sat, 17 Apr 2021 10:35:28 +0000 (12:35 +0200)]
Add tests for utils

3 years agoUpdate the config
Ruben Beltran del Rio [Thu, 15 Apr 2021 21:18:09 +0000 (23:18 +0200)]
Update the config

3 years agoPort to sveltekit
Ruben Beltran del Rio [Thu, 15 Apr 2021 21:06:26 +0000 (23:06 +0200)]
Port to sveltekit

3 years agoAllow for conditional reply
Ruben Beltran del Rio [Mon, 12 Apr 2021 13:42:43 +0000 (15:42 +0200)]
Allow for conditional reply

3 years agoUse only src for aliases
Ruben Beltran del Rio [Sun, 14 Mar 2021 22:11:04 +0000 (23:11 +0100)]
Use only src for aliases

3 years agoAdd components to view topics and posts
Ruben Beltran del Rio [Sun, 14 Mar 2021 22:10:01 +0000 (23:10 +0100)]
Add components to view topics and posts

3 years agoAdd tag component:
Ruben Beltran del Rio [Sun, 14 Mar 2021 22:08:44 +0000 (23:08 +0100)]
Add tag component:

3 years agoAdd post content component
Ruben Beltran del Rio [Sun, 14 Mar 2021 22:07:13 +0000 (23:07 +0100)]
Add post content component

3 years agoAdd loader component
Ruben Beltran del Rio [Sun, 14 Mar 2021 22:06:48 +0000 (23:06 +0100)]
Add loader component

3 years agoUpdate translations
Ruben Beltran del Rio [Sun, 14 Mar 2021 22:06:35 +0000 (23:06 +0100)]
Update translations

3 years agoIgnore dashes in glyph hash
Ruben Beltran del Rio [Sun, 14 Mar 2021 21:46:06 +0000 (22:46 +0100)]
Ignore dashes in glyph hash

3 years agoAdd animation to error block
Ruben Beltran del Rio [Sun, 14 Mar 2021 21:45:22 +0000 (22:45 +0100)]
Add animation to error block

3 years agoAdd stores for GraphQL data:
Ruben Beltran del Rio [Sun, 14 Mar 2021 21:41:16 +0000 (22:41 +0100)]
Add stores for GraphQL data:

3 years agoUse routify and GraphQL server
Ruben Beltran del Rio [Sat, 13 Mar 2021 14:28:29 +0000 (15:28 +0100)]
Use routify and GraphQL server

3 years agoUpdate to SvelteKit
Ruben Beltran del Rio [Tue, 9 Mar 2021 21:43:12 +0000 (22:43 +0100)]
Update to SvelteKit

3 years agoAdd internationalization support
Ben Beltran [Sat, 20 Jun 2020 14:20:31 +0000 (16:20 +0200)]
Add internationalization support

3 years agoAdd retries to socket coordinator
Ben Beltran [Sat, 20 Jun 2020 12:58:47 +0000 (14:58 +0200)]
Add retries to socket coordinator

3 years agoAdd internationalized error block
Ben Beltran [Sat, 20 Jun 2020 12:58:26 +0000 (14:58 +0200)]
Add internationalized error block

3 years agoUpdate dependencies
Ben Beltran [Sat, 20 Jun 2020 12:57:39 +0000 (14:57 +0200)]
Update dependencies

4 years agoConnect forum store to changefeed
Ben Beltran [Mon, 23 Mar 2020 18:12:50 +0000 (12:12 -0600)]
Connect forum store to changefeed

4 years agoRemove server
Ben Beltran [Sun, 22 Mar 2020 17:53:13 +0000 (11:53 -0600)]
Remove server

4 years agoAdd svelte linting
Ben Beltran [Tue, 18 Feb 2020 22:34:51 +0000 (23:34 +0100)]
Add svelte linting

4 years agoFix linter and linteer warnings
Ben Beltran [Sat, 15 Feb 2020 22:03:37 +0000 (23:03 +0100)]
Fix linter and linteer warnings

4 years agoAdd a router
Ben Beltran [Sun, 2 Feb 2020 12:12:13 +0000 (13:12 +0100)]
Add a router

4 years agoMake permalinks more legible
Ben Beltran [Sun, 26 Jan 2020 15:49:20 +0000 (16:49 +0100)]
Make permalinks more legible

In chrome the time will be read out as a "group, editable"
so adding the role presentation helps it read out correctly
with VoiceOver.

4 years agoAdd skeleton for topic
Ben Beltran [Sun, 26 Jan 2020 15:33:43 +0000 (16:33 +0100)]
Add skeleton for topic

Tested with VoiceOver

4 years agoAdd JSDoc config
Ben Beltran [Mon, 23 Dec 2019 00:08:03 +0000 (01:08 +0100)]
Add JSDoc config

4 years agoAdd Changelog
Ben Beltran [Sun, 22 Dec 2019 23:40:30 +0000 (00:40 +0100)]
Add Changelog

4 years agoAdd a contributing guide
Ben Beltran [Sun, 22 Dec 2019 23:40:13 +0000 (00:40 +0100)]
Add a contributing guide

4 years agoAdd a README
Ben Beltran [Sun, 22 Dec 2019 23:26:29 +0000 (00:26 +0100)]
Add a README

4 years agoAdd svelte frontend
Ben Beltran [Sun, 22 Dec 2019 23:24:21 +0000 (00:24 +0100)]
Add svelte frontend

4 years agoAdd linting config
Ben Beltran [Sun, 22 Dec 2019 23:23:02 +0000 (00:23 +0100)]
Add linting config

4 years agoAdd backend files
Ben Beltran [Sun, 22 Dec 2019 23:21:35 +0000 (00:21 +0100)]
Add backend files

4 years agoAdd git hooks
Ben Beltran [Sun, 22 Dec 2019 23:21:06 +0000 (00:21 +0100)]
Add git hooks

4 years agoIgnore .env file
Ben Beltran [Sun, 22 Dec 2019 23:20:40 +0000 (00:20 +0100)]
Ignore .env file

5 years agoAdd LICENSE
Rubén Beltran del Río [Wed, 14 Nov 2018 23:06:41 +0000 (23:06 +0000)]
Add LICENSE

5 years agoInitial commit
Rubén Beltran del Río [Wed, 14 Nov 2018 23:06:21 +0000 (23:06 +0000)]
Initial commit